John CLARK Obituary
June 20,1939-March 31,2025
It is with heavy heart we announced the passing of our beloved father and grandpa on March 31, 2025. John loved his children, grandchildren and great grandchildren. He will be missed dearly by friends and family.
John is predeceased by his wife Margaret Clark (2010) his father John, his mother Marjorie and his two sisters Joan and Janet. He leaves behind his 5 children Donna ( Greg ), Brad, Steve ( Jadine ), Anita, Lance ( Kelly) and his brother Ronald ( Marie ).Sadly, he has also leaves behind grandchildren and great grandchildren. Who he thought of fondly.
John was born on June 20, 1939, in England . He served in the Navy and worked for BCFP Youbou saw mill as an industrial electrician. He enjoyed his cars, camping, all animals and spending time with his family and friends
We would like to thank the doctors and nurses for their time and care as they tended to our dad.
No funeral or no service at his request. There will be a private burial ceremony.
In lieu of flowers a donation can be made in his name to the BC Cancer Foundation
